Transaction 3139baef7643f9900bde051ddc9f65c3f5a4fbfb014b952e8dd672b6843d86c8

1 Input
2 Outputs
  • 3139baef7643f9900bde051ddc9f65c3f5a4fbfb014b952e8dd672b6843d86c8:0
  • value  3761
    address  1PuEEbdwG9jyEEd6wo6kS1rDW7b1YfekWG
  • 3139baef7643f9900bde051ddc9f65c3f5a4fbfb014b952e8dd672b6843d86c8:1
  • value  17149
    address  34CNcQ9Jv1Ltfv9kMhSfWH2kCHv5weD8Fn